What features should I look for in a 2-person U-shaped desk?

Choosing the right 2-person U-shaped desk requires careful consideration of several key features.

1. Dimensions and Space: Measure your available office space meticulously before purchasing. Consider not only the desk's footprint but also the necessary clearance for chairs and movement around the desk.

2. Material: The material of the desk impacts its durability, aesthetics, and price. Popular choices include wood (solid wood or wood veneer), laminate, and metal. Each material has its own pros and cons regarding durability, maintenance, and style.

3. Storage: Integrated storage solutions, such as drawers, cabinets, or shelves, are invaluable for keeping your workspace organized. Consider the type and amount of storage you need based on your individual requirements.

4. Cable Management: Effective cable management is crucial for maintaining a clean and organized workspace. Look for desks with built-in cable management systems to keep wires neatly tucked away.

5. Adjustability: Consider desks with adjustable height features, particularly if you and your colleague have different height preferences. This ensures ergonomic comfort for both users.

What are the different types of 2-person U-shaped desks?

The market offers various types of 2-person U-shaped desks catering to different needs and styles.

  • Standard U-Shaped Desks: These offer a classic U-shape with a central shared workspace and individual workspaces on either side.
  • Modular U-Shaped Desks: These allow for customization, letting you adjust the configuration to suit your space and specific needs.
  • L-Shaped Desks with Additions: Sometimes, two L-shaped desks can be combined with a connecting piece to create a U-shaped setup.

How much space do I need for a 2-person U-shaped desk?

The amount of space required depends heavily on the dimensions of the desk itself and the additional space needed for chairs and comfortable movement. As a general rule, allow at least 10-12 feet of floor space, but accurately measuring your space is crucial to avoid overcrowding.

What are some alternatives to a 2-person U-shaped desk?

While U-shaped desks offer excellent solutions, alternative options exist for collaborative workspaces:

  • Two L-shaped desks back-to-back: This allows for individual space but limits face-to-face interaction.
  • Large rectangular desk with a partition: This allows for shared space but might feel less collaborative than a U-shaped design.
  • Separate desks with a shared central table: This combines individual workspaces with a collaborative central area.
